Aloha Bagel is Amelia Island’s brightest little Bagel Shop. With eleven different bagel varieties, lots of delicious homemade cream cheeses, breakfast sandwiches, salads, enormous sandwiches and yummy sweet treats, you’re bound to find something for everyone!
